SPOT-I-PÊCHE
Spot-I-Pêche
A bilingual mobile companion that helps Quebec anglers discover fishing spots, identify fishing zones, check regulations, and log or share catches.
Product owner and full-stack mobile developer — product direction, UI, mobile development, Firebase architecture, data imports, and integrations, with collaborator support for offline functionality

What Shipped
- Interactive map with GPS zone detection, water bodies, weather, regulations, and 660 curated fishing spots
- Bilingual English/French onboarding, authentication, settings, saved zones, and trophy catch logging
- Firebase-backed public spots and Spoti community feed with offline data support
- Premium architecture for trophy spots, offline downloads, and RevenueCat subscriptions

Quebec anglers must navigate fragmented information about fishing zones, water bodies, regulations, and suitable fishing locations while also lacking a dedicated place to track and share catches.
Outcome
Android MVP runs on physical devices through Expo Go. Firestore contains 660 imported fishing spots; core map, regulation, trophy, and community flows are functional with optimized viewport performance. Store builds, production subscriptions, final QA, and App Store / Google Play publication remain in progress.
